C725
Alternator
OEM Installation Instructions
Page 1 of 1
II208A
This symbol is used to indicate the
presence of hazards that can cause minor
personal injury or property damage.
CAUTION
CAUTION
1. Install alternator as shown in Figure 1:
Slip bushing located in rear mounting
foot must be securely tightened against
alternator mounting bracket on engine.
Failure to do so can result in broken
mounting feet or broken upper mounting
bracket.
a. Use hardened washers between aluminum
surfaces and bolt heads and nuts.
b. OEM units are shipped with pulley, hardened
washer and locknut installed. Locknut should
be torqued to 163 Nm/ 120 lb. ft.
c. Follow vehicle manufacturer’s recommenda-
tions for belt tension.
2. All cabling, wiring or conduit must be supported
within 305 mm/12 in. of termination on alternator.
3. Choose wire gauge capable of handling maximum
alternator output with no more than 0.4 V drop
(28 V)/0.2 V drop (14 V) on each leg from
alternator to battery.
4. Regulator is furnished with OEM units.
CAUTION
5. Make electrical connections to CEN regulator,
using proper ring terminals.
a. Make sure alternator-to-regulator harnesses
are plugged securely in regulator receptacles.
b. Connect IGN terminal on regulator to 28 V
keyed ignition switch source. Torque #10-32
terminal nut to 3.4 Nm/30 lb. in.
6. Alternator electrical connections:
a. Connect battery positive cables from vehicle
to alternator 28 V B+ and 14 V B+ terminals.
Torque both 0.50-18 UNC-2A terminal bolts
on alternator to 23 Nm/17 lb. ft.
B+ cables must be supported by
cable clamps within 12’’ of both
B+ output terminals to avoid
premature failure of B+ output
terminals. CEN recommends
using cable clamps attached to
alternator anti-drive end housing
for support.
b. Connect ground cable from vehicle to alter-
nator B– terminal. Torque 0.3750-16 UNC-2A
B– terminal bolt on alternator to 23 Nm/
17 lb. ft.
